Python 熊猫中堆叠/取消堆叠、形状和轴之间的差异
我对python非常陌生,我开始阅读使用pandas的大数据分析 我的任务是把下表从长形变成高形Python 熊猫中堆叠/取消堆叠、形状和轴之间的差异,python,pandas,data-analysis,Python,Pandas,Data Analysis,我对python非常陌生,我开始阅读使用pandas的大数据分析 我的任务是把下表从长形变成高形 Pick 'n Pay Woolworths Spar Checkers Friendly 7 0 22.222222 11.111111 44.444444 NaN NaN 1 8.333333 5.555556 8.333333 11.111111 33.333333 2 8.982036 7.18
Pick 'n Pay Woolworths Spar Checkers Friendly 7
0 22.222222 11.111111 44.444444 NaN NaN
1 8.333333 5.555556 8.333333 11.111111 33.333333
2 8.982036 7.185629 11.976048 35.928144 NaN
3 12.500000 37.500000 37.500000 12.500000 NaN
我最初的想法是应该使用重塑,但最终我决定使用df.stack
这让我想到了一个问题:堆叠/拆垛、重塑和旋转之间的区别是什么?每种情况应使用哪种级别?默认级别是最内层的级别 堆栈-将列传输到行 取消堆叠-将行转移到列